Apple's Cautious AI Strategy Could Have Been Its Smartest Move

Commentary: Some say Apple is lagging behind in the AI gold rush. I think the company has positioned itself strategically.

CNET 3 min read 7/10 Cupertino
Apple's Cautious AI Strategy Could Have Been Its Smartest Move
Key Takeaways
  • Apple's installed base exceeds 2 billion active devices, giving it a unique launchpad for on-device AI features without relying on cloud subscription models.
  • The A17 Pro and M3 chips include a 16-core Neural Engine capable of 35 trillion operations per second, enabling real-time generative AI tasks locally.
  • Apple has acquired at least 32 AI startups since 2017, including DarwinAI in 2024 and Voysis in 2020, to bolster on-device intelligence.
  • At WWDC 2025, Apple is expected to introduce a revamped Siri with on-device LLM capabilities, AI-generated emoji, and live call transcriptions — all processed locally.
  • Apple's privacy-focused AI stance contrasts sharply with competitors: Google Gemini, Microsoft Copilot, and OpenAI ChatGPT all rely heavily on cloud processing and user data collection.
Apple is moving at its own pace in the artificial intelligence race — and that could be its greatest advantage. While rivals like Google, Microsoft, and OpenAI have rushed to deploy generative AI tools, Apple has taken a measured approach focused on privacy, on-device processing, and integration with its existing ecosystem. At WWDC 2025, the company is expected to unveil a suite of AI features that prioritize user experience over flashy demos, signaling that Apple's strategic patience may pay off in the long run.

Apple's AI strategy has often been criticized as slow. Competitors launched chatbots, code assistants, and generative search tools at breakneck speed. But Apple, with its massive installed base of over 2 billion devices, has the luxury of waiting. The company's core philosophy — seamless user experience coupled with ironclad privacy — shapes every AI decision. Instead of cloud-dependent chatbots, Apple focuses on on-device machine learning that processes data locally, never sending it to servers. This approach reduces latency, protects user privacy, and leverages Apple's custom silicon, such as the Neural Engine in its A-series and M-series chips.

The context for this strategy is the post-ChatGPT frenzy that began in late 2022. Google launched Bard (now Gemini), Microsoft integrated Copilot into Office and Windows, and OpenAI continued to dominate headlines with GPT-4 and GPT-4o. Meanwhile, Apple remained quiet, making only incremental improvements to Siri and adding smaller ML features like Live Text and Visual Look Up. Critics argued Apple had missed the wave. But internally, Apple was preparing a massive AI push — not through a single product, but across its entire ecosystem.

At WWDC 2025, Apple is expected to announce major AI updates for iOS, iPadOS, macOS, and watchOS. Key details likely include a revamped Siri with deeper third-party app integration, real-time transcription and summarization in Notes and Messages, AI-generated emoji and image editing tools in Photos, and a new on-device LLM that powers contextual suggestions. Importantly, these features will run mostly on the device, with optional cloud augmentation using Apple's private cloud compute. The company has also been hiring top AI researchers and quietly acquiring startups like DarwinAI to bolster its capabilities.

Industry analysts see Apple's strategy as a masterstroke in differentiation. By embedding AI into the operating system rather than offering a standalone chatbot, Apple avoids the data privacy scandals that have plagued competitors. It also turns AI into a reason to upgrade hardware, as older iPhones lack the processing power for advanced on-device models. This creates a virtuous cycle: users buy new iPhones for better AI, developers build apps on Apple's ML frameworks, and Apple reinforces its walled garden. As Forrester analyst Dipanjan Chatterjee notes, 'Apple is not behind in AI — it's playing a different game. One where trust and integration matter more than speed.'

The outlook is tilting in Apple's favor. While early generative AI adoption has been high, enterprises and consumers are growing concerned about privacy, cost, and reliability. Apple's message — that AI should work for you, not the cloud — resonates increasingly. The company's share price has remained resilient despite missing the initial AI rally, and services revenue continues to grow. Key milestones to watch include the WWDC keynote, potential licensing deals with content providers for training data, and how developers react to new AI APIs. If Apple executes, its cautious AI strategy could indeed be its smartest move yet, setting a standard for responsible innovation that others will have to follow.
